Figure 1 from: Garduño-Montes de Oca EU, López-Caballero JD, Mata-López R (2017) New records of helminths of Sceloporus pyrocephalus Cope (Squamata, Phrynosomatidae) from Guerrero and Michoacán, Mexico, with the description of a new species of Thubunaea Seurat, 1914 (Nematoda, Physalopteridae). ZooKeys 716: 43-62. https://doi.org/10.3897/zookeys.716.13724

Figure 1 - Thubunaea leonregagnonae sp. n. A Anterior end, female, lateral view B Apical view, female C Anterior end, female, lateral view showing excretory pore and vulva D Embryonated egg, lateral view E Larvated egg, lateral view F Caudal end, male, ventral view G Caudal end, male, lateral view, caudal papillae and ornamentation not shown H Caudal end, female, lateral view. Scale bars: A 90 µm; B 20 µm; C 370 µm; D 25 µm; E 30µm; F 250 µm; G 50 µm; H 370 µm.

Figure 2 from: Garduño-Montes de Oca EU, López-Caballero JD, Mata-López R (2017) New records of helminths of Sceloporus pyrocephalus Cope (Squamata, Phrynosomatidae) from Guerrero and Michoacán, Mexico, with the description of a new species of Thubunaea Seurat, 1914 (Nematoda, Physalopteridae). ZooKeys 716: 43-62. https://doi.org/10.3897/zookeys.716.13724

Figure 2 - Thubunaea leonregagnonae sp. n. Scanning electron micrographs. A Anterior end, male, lateral view showing deirid (D) B Apical view, female, showing sub-median papillae (P) and amphids (A) C Deirid, lateral view D Posterior end, female, ventrolateral view E Posterior end, male, ventral view F Caudal end, male, ventral view. Scale bars: A 50 µm; B 10 µm; C 2.5 µm; D 50 µm; E 100 µm; F 50 µm.

Data from: Multiple data sets, congruence, and hypothesis testing for the phylogeny of basal groups of the lizard genus Sceloporus (Squamata, Phrynosomatidae)

Several data partitions, including nuclear and mitochondrial gene sequences, chromosomes, isozymes, and morphological characters, were used to propose a new phylogeny and to test previously published hypotheses about the phylogenetic positions of basal clades of the lizard genus Sceloporus and the relationship of Sceloporus to the former genus "Sator". In accord with earlier studies, our results grouped "Sator" internal to Sceloporus, and both support a hypothesis of transgulfian vicariance for the origin of the former genus "Sator" on islands in the Sea of Cortez. Robustness of support for internal nodes in our best tree was established though widely used indices (bootstrap proportions, decay values) but also through congruence among independent data partitions. Several deep nodes in the tree recovered by a number of methods, including equally weighted and differentially weighted parsimony, and maximum likelihood models, are only weakly supported by the traditional indices, and this methodological concordance is taken as evidence for insensitivity of the deep structure of the topology to alternate assumptions.
